Make sure your machine is compatible with your chosen upgrade before you buy. Most MacBooks can handle volumes up to 2 TB, while others are restricted to 1 TB. In terms of cost, it’s around $300 for a 1 TB upgrade as part of a kit, or $250 for just the drive. Get a big enough drive that you’re sure to notice the difference. If you opt for the kit, you get the SSD upgrade, required tools, and an enclosure into which you can place your old drive to transfer data. Other World Computing sells MacBook (and other Mac) SSD upgrades in two flavors: drive only, or as a kit. If you have a supported model, the easiest way to upgrade is to purchase a kit. If your model isn’t supported, then, unfortunately, you can’t upgrade the SSD.
